Account Executive Salary Overview
Salaries for Account Executives are influenced by experience, industry, and geographic location. Certifications and performance metrics can also significantly impact earnings.
National Average: $50,000 - $110,000 per year
Experience-Based Salary Ranges
Entry Level (0-2 years)
$50,000 - $65,000
Mid Level (3-5 years)
$66,000 - $85,000
Senior Level (6-9 years)
$86,000 - $105,000
Manager/Director (10+ years)
$106,000 - $130,000+

Regional Salary Variations
Account Executive salaries vary significantly by region, largely due to cost of living differences and regional demand for sales roles.
New York City
$70,000 - $120,000
San Francisco
$75,000 - $130,000
Chicago
$65,000 - $105,000
Los Angeles
$68,000 - $115,000
Dallas
$60,000 - $100,000
Atlanta
$58,000 - $95,000
Phoenix
$55,000 - $90,000
Remote (US-based)
$60,000 - $110,000

Industry Salary Comparison
Account Executive salaries can differ based on the industry, with technology and finance sectors generally offering higher compensation compared to others.
Industry | Salary Range | Bonus/Equity | Growth Potential |
---|---|---|---|
Technology | $70,000 - $130,000 | High | Very Good |
Finance | $65,000 - $120,000 | Moderate | Good |
Healthcare | $60,000 - $110,000 | Moderate | Stable |
Retail | $55,000 - $95,000 | Low | Limited |
Manufacturing | $58,000 - $98,000 | Low | Stable |
